Description :

Original abstract black‑and‑white limited edition artist proof by Latvian‑American artist Karlis Rekevics, numbered 4/14 and signed/dated 8/8/84. Acquired directly from the artist during his period living in Seattle, offering strong provenance and a direct connection to his early Pacific Northwest work.

The print presents Rekevics’ characteristic structural sensibility—an interplay of architectural rhythm, negative space, and controlled abstraction. Surfaces show expected age‑appropriate toning consistent with careful long‑term storage.

Artist Bio: Karlis Rekevics (b. 1952) is a Latvian‑American sculptor and printmaker recognized for his exploration of architectural form, spatial memory, and the built environment. After immigrating to the United States, Rekevics spent time in Seattle in the early 1980s, producing a small body of works on paper that reflect his developing interest in geometric abstraction and urban structure. He later became known for large‑scale sculptural installations exhibited throughout the U.S. and Europe. Early Seattle‑period works—such as this limited edition artist proof—are valued for their rarity and for capturing the emergence of the visual language that would define his mature career.
